Guns N’ Roses Discography: From the Jungle to the Chinese Democracy

When Guns N’ Roses exploded onto the Sunset Strip in the mid-80s, they didn’t just release music—they detonated a bomb under the plastic, hair-sprayed world of glam metal. Combining the raw punk energy of the Stooges, the bluesy swagger of The Rolling Stones, and the lyrical darkness of punk rock, they became "The Most Dangerous Band in the World."

Here is a definitive guide to the studio catalog of W. Axl Rose, Slash, Duff McKagan, Izzy Stradlin, and Steven Adler (and the many lineups that followed). Discografia - Gun--s N Roses


1. Appetite for Destruction (1987)

Label: Geffen Records | Producer: Mike Clink Guns N’ Roses Discography: From the Jungle to

The debut album is a landmark. Initially rejected for its violent "robot rape" cover art (eventually replaced by the iconic skulls-and-crosses design), Appetite spent two years climbing the charts before becoming the best-selling debut album of all time in the U.S. (over 18 million copies sold). 7. Absurd (Single - 2021) & Hard Skool (Single - 2021)

The Return of the Slash. For the first time since 1993, Axl, Slash, and Duff released new music together. These tracks were reworked from the Chinese Democracy sessions, but Slash’s bluesy leads and Duff’s driving bass transformed them into legitimate Guns N' Roses tracks. They bridged the gap between Axl's industrial leanings and the band's classic sound.

Phase III: Not in This Lifetime (2016–Present)

In 2016, Axl Rose and Slash reunited for the "Not in This Lifetime" tour, bringing the band back to stadium status.
